Job Guide: Performance Review (Self Evaluation – Attachment Only)

OverviewThis job guide outlines the steps for an Employee to complete the Annual Performance Review (Self Evaluation – Attachment Only) process in Workday.

Prerequisites: The Performance Evaluation is launched each year by Human Resources &

Organizational Effectiveness. The tasks will appear in employee inboxes once launched.

The following employee types receive the Attachment Only Self Evaluation:

o Management Levels 1-5

Chief Executive

Executive Management

Senior Management

Administrative Management

Director (includes Assistant & Associate Director)

o Research Professionals – Other

All other employees will receive the Self Evaluation - Staff template. Guidance on this template can be found in the Annual Performance Review (Self Evaluation - Staff) Job Guide.

Important Information: Self evaluation is a good practice to reflect on accomplishments, what went well,

what could have gone better, and what one may have learned over the past year.

Employees should check with their Manager if a Self Evaluation is required or not.

Even if the Manager does not require the self evaluation, employees MUST submit a self evaluation. The self evaluation can be submitted blank.

Goals are not used on the Attachment Only Self Evaluation template.

Step: Screenshot:

1. Navigate to the Workday Inbox.

2. Click on the Self Evaluation task in the Inbox.

Step: Screenshot:

3. The evaluation may be completed in one of two ways:

Guided Editor: A step-by-step guide through each section.

Summary Editor: Displays every section on a single page.

For this example, we will be using the Guided Editor.

4. The first section is Attachments. Attachments are not required.

To attach a document, click Add.

Step: Screenshot:

5. To select a file to attach to the evaluation, click Attach.

Note: The attachment type can be any format the Manager chooses, such as a memo, the Performance Feedback Form, or a spreadsheet. The Performance Feedback Form is located at https://employees.tamu.edu/media/346443/performance_feedback_form_102.docx.

6. Browse and select the file to attach, then click Open.

Step: Screenshot:

7. The file is now attached to the Evaluation.

A. Enter a Comment (optional) explaining the attachment.

B. Click the checkmark when done.

C. Click Add to add another attachment, if needed.

8. Add an overall Comment about the attachments in the Summary section.

Click Next to move to the Overall Rating page.

Step: Screenshot:

9. You can provide an Overall Rating for performance during the year.

A. Select a Rating (optional).

B. Enter a Comment (optional).

C. Click Next to move to the Summary page.

Step: Screenshot:

10. The Summary view is the same as using the Summary Editor instead of the Step-by-Step. This allows employees to review the self evaluation and make any needed changes.

Make any changes that are needed, then Click Submit to complete the Self Evaluation.

Note: Once submitted, changes may not be made unless the Manager uses the Send Back option in the Manager Evaluation.

11. The Self Evaluation is submitted. Up next is the Manager.

This completes the Attachment Only Self Evaluation business process.
